Insider Buying at Establishment Labs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:ESTA)

Establishment Labs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:ESTA) operates in the medical technology sector, focusing on the development and manufacturing of advanced breast implants and other medical devices. The company competes with other firms in the medical device industry, striving to innovate and expand its market presence.

On August 11, 2025, CEO Caldini Filippo purchased 2,850 shares of the company's common stock at $35.20 per share, increasing his total ownership to 35,245 shares. Such insider buying can be seen as a positive signal, indicating confidence in the company's future prospects despite its current financial challenges.

ESTA's recent Q2 2025 earnings call provided insights into the company's financial performance. Despite a negative price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of -11.14, the company is actively engaging with analysts to discuss its strategic direction.

The company's financial metrics reveal some challenges, with a price-to-sales ratio of 5.59 and an enterprise value to sales ratio of 5.30. The negative enterprise value to operating cash flow ratio of -13.80 indicates negative operating cash flow, while the earnings yield of -8.98% highlights ongoing financial difficulties.

Despite these challenges, ESTA maintains a strong liquidity position with a current ratio of 2.84, suggesting it can cover short-term liabilities. The debt-to-equity ratio is low at 0.15, indicating conservative debt usage. These factors, combined with insider buying, suggest a cautious yet optimistic outlook for the company's future.
